Embedded systems commonly use several types of timers, including hardware timers, software timers, and real-time clocks (RTCs). Hardware timers are integrated into microcontrollers and provide precise timing for events and interrupts. Software timers, implemented in the system's firmware, help manage time-based operations without dedicated hardware. Real-time clocks maintain time and date information even when the system is powered off, ensuring accurate timekeeping in applications like scheduling and logging.
C language is mostly used in most of the embedded systems. python is used for hardware related production and unix used to automated testing
An embedded operating system is an operating system for embedded computer systems. These operating systems are designed to be compact, efficient, and reliable, forsaking many functions that non-embedded computer operating systems provide, and which may not be used by the specialized applications they run.
Automobile
Embedded systems are commonly classified based on performance, functionality, and complexity: 1️⃣ Based on Performance Small-Scale Embedded Systems – Simple systems using microcontrollers (e.g., TV remote). Medium-Scale Embedded Systems – More complex, may use RTOS (e.g., printers, smart meters). Large-Scale Embedded Systems – Highly complex systems with powerful processors (e.g., aircraft control systems). 2️⃣ Based on Functionality Standalone Embedded Systems – Work independently (e.g., microwave oven). Real-Time Embedded Systems – Must respond within strict time limits (e.g., airbags). Networked Embedded Systems – Connected via networks (e.g., IoT devices). Mobile Embedded Systems – Used in portable devices (e.g., smartphones). These classifications help in understanding design requirements and system complexity.
Embedded systems are used to manage a certain operation inside of a device. Embedded systems are often merely made to carry out this task repeatedly, but more advanced ones can take control of whole operating systems.
CANopen is a device profile specification for embedded systems used in automation. It is considered to be one of the most popular devices in this field.
It is a micro controller used in various applications of embedded systems
they r used in the real time world
It is used for various instruction set and interrupt systems also. They were a popular, early, microprocessor commonly embedded in washing machines and domestic appliances, to replace mechanical timers and interlocks.
It is used to identify the persons location and to direct persons to other specific direction.
Yes an embedded system by definition is a combination of hardware and software,here both are combined together for a specific task .
Electrical timers were first introduced in the early 20th century, with significant advancements made in the 1920s and 1930s as electricity became more widely accessible. These timers were initially used in industrial applications and home appliances to automate processes and control timing functions. The development of more sophisticated electronic timers followed in the latter half of the century, leading to their widespread use in various devices and systems.